Condition
Overall fine condition. Wear commensurate with age and use. The interior of the lid shows a 1-inch by 1/2-inch repair just above the joint with the hinge. The upper and lower mounts of the handle shows some discoloration which may be an old repair or perhaps just flaws from manufacture.
